HEATHER GILLIS BAND ROCKS IT ‘SOUTHERN STYLE’ ON FIRST TOUR BEGINNING AUGUST 5 IN ATLANTA

Former Vocalist-Guitarist w/ Butch Trucks & the Freight Train Performs at Roots Rock Revival in NY “In Honor of Butch Trucks’, Blues N Brew Festival, Trois-Rivieres En Blues in Quebec, Canada

Heather Gillis, guitarist-vocalist with Butch Trucks and the Freight Train featuring late Allman Brothers drummer Butch Trucks, rocks it ‘Southern Style’ on her first Tour as the Heather Gillis Band, with the first show at Darwin’s Burgers and Blues, 234 Hilderbrand Dr., Saturday, August 5. Showtime: 9:30pm. Tickets $10. Info: (470) 399-5060 or http://darwinsburgers.com/.

The youthful Gillis is the complete Rock/Soul/Roots (and Blues) package as a guitar player, lap steel player, songwriter, singer and arranger. At only twenty years of age, she was discovered by Trucks in Florida in 2015 and personally recruited by him to play in the Freight Train, the latter who performed to packed houses all over the U.S. until Trucks’ sudden passing in January 2017. “(Gillis) proves to be the perfect touch to the band with her stage presence, energy, and tremendous talent,” writes American Blues Scene in a recent interview. The Tallahassee Democrat opines, “anytime Heather Gillis plugs in an electric guitar and starts to play, you know immediately it’s her. She has a distinct tone and muscular sound that usually takes other, older guitarists many more years to develop. You should hear her belt out ‘Whipping Post.’

Formerly from Florida and now residing in Atlanta, Gillis recently performed at the Tall City Blues Festival and plays some high-profile events during the upcoming tour: a five-day Roots Rock Revival tribute to Butch Trucks and Col. Bruce Hampton in Big Indian, New York, August 13 through August 18; and the Blues & Brews Festival in Westford, Mass on August 20 (complete Tour Itinerary below).

In addition to Butch Trucks, Gillis has performed with members of the Allman Brothers Band; the aforementioned Col. Bruce Hampton; The Lee Boys; North Mississippi All-Stars; Matt Schofield; and more. Heather’s live shows are high-energy and consist of her originals as well as some choice cover tunes.
